Subject: [PATCH v6 0/6] mfd: axp20x: add AXP221 PMIC support
Date: Wed, 1 Apr 2015 14:03:17 +0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1427868203-7486-1-git-send-email-wens@csie.org> (raw)
Hi Lee,
This is v6 of the AXP221 series. This version is based on mfd-for-next
(ba867bc60a44). The DTS patches are merged through Maxime's tree, so
I dropped them.
I think it'd be easier if you take all the patches through your tree.
Otherwise, patch 4 depends on patch 1, and you'd need to setup a
common branch with Mark.
Changes since v5:
- Rebased onto mfd-for-next (ba867bc60a44)
- Dropped dts patches
- Removed double line spacing
Changes since v4:
- Rebased onto v4.0-rc1 and axp20x bindings v10
- Dropped regulator set registration patches
- Group regmap ranges/tables by AXP variant
- Fix AXP221 interrupt numbers to match datasheet
- Handle AXP variants when setting DC-DC regulator work mode
- Add "switch" type regulator DC1SW, which is a secondary output
of DCDC1 with a separate on/off switch.
- Add AXP221 to DT bindings
